I have setup scpm on opensuse 10.2 and have configured two profiles
WORK and HOME.  If I am at a shell prompt and run the command scpm
switch home (or work) the system will switch to the named profile and
all of the settings necessary to operate will work.

Here's the problem, if I go to work and boot the machine and from the
grub menu hit F3 work and I had been at home the system will boot to
the home profile.  That is to say that whatever the last profile I was
actively in will be the one it boots to no matter what I choose at the
boot menu.  Once the system boots I can open a shell and become root
and use scpm switch work (or home) and it will change to that profile.
But I have to do this manually after each boot  when I go from work
to home or vice versa.

Does anybody have any ideas what the problem might be, I would
appreciate any suggestions.
